LISTEN TO THE PLUGGED IN SHOW, EPISODE 111
Another year has come and gone. And that can only mean one thing: It’s time to turn around and take one last look at the entertainment and technology stories that impacted our culture and our families over the previous 12 months.
It’s always fun to talk about what we thought the biggest headlines were from the last year. And we found plenty of conversation fodder in 2021. What in the world is Meta anyway? Why is Friends having a reunion on HBO almost two decades after TV finale? Will screen time ever not be an issue? And why do we care so much what British royals (or former royals?) do?
Those stories and more take center stage in our Plugged In Show conversation this week.
